内容記述 Radiocesium (134Cs+137Cs) concentrations in foods are of great concern since the Fukushima Daiichi Nuclear Power Plant (FDNPP) accident as people want to avoid receiving additional internal dose from ingestion of the radionuclide. Food monitoring has been carried out, and, if any food exceeds the Japanese standard limit for radiocesium, that is, 100 Bq/kg-wet, the food name together with the producing district has been reported immediately by the Ministry of Health, Labour and Welfare (MHLW). Every month, radioactivities of more than 20,000 samples are being measured and the most recent data of April 2014 (MHLW, 2014) showed that foods exceeding the standard limits were mostly from the wild (that is, not commercially grown or raised).
One of the public’s main concerns is how to decrease ingestion of radiocesium from foods, especially foods they have collected from the wild as well as from their home-grown garden vegetables because radioactivities in these foods have not been measured for many cases. Unfortunately, radiocesium removal data by food processing, including culinary preparation, for crops commonly consumed in Japan have been very limited because of little interest in the topic before the FDNPP accident. To remedy this, we have begun collecting such data (Tagami et al., 2012; Tagami and Uchida, 2013). Recently, the Radioactive Waste Management Funding and Research Center (RWMC) compiled the radiocesium removal ratios by food processing using open source data published mainly in 2011 and 2012 (RWMC, 2013). In the present study, we focused on food processing effects on radiocesium removal in food plants from the wild to add more information and we compared obtained values with previously compiled values in the IAEA Technical Report Series No. 472 (2010). We also measured potassium-40 concentrations in the same samples for comparison with radiocesium.
